"INNDIH AI CONNECT"INNDIH AI CONNECT - VALENCIA REGION DIGITAL INNOVATION HUB DESCRIPTIONINNDIH AI Connect is the continuation and consolidation of the European Digital Innovation Hub (EDIH) for the Valencia Region, acting as a specialized "one-stop-shop" to help small and medium enterprises (SMEs) and the public sector adopt digital technologies. This initiative represents a major collaboration between businesses, universities, research centers, and public agencies, all working together to modernize the local economy. While the project focuses heavily on Artificial Intelligence (AI), it also provides expertise in robotics, big data, cybersecurity, and high-performance computing. By targeting strategic areas like Advanced Manufacturing and Quality of Life (Health), it ensures that the region's core industries stay competitive in a digital world. As a member of a pan-European network, the project connects Valencia to the latest digital innovations across the continent.
